We'd like to request a small GPU allocation for a Gradio Space that will host the interactive demo of our new work, PaGeR: Panorama Geometry Reconstruction.
๐ Project page: https://pager360.github.io/
๐ Paper: https://arxiv.org/abs/2605.26368
PaGeR estimates high-quality 360ยฐ scene geometry โ dense depth and surface normals โ from a single panoramic image, producing results that can be lifted directly into 3D point clouds. Geometry estimation for omnidirectional imagery is still underserved by public tooling, and a GPU is needed to run inference at interactive speeds on full-resolution equirectangular panoramas. Providing a public demo will let the community:
โข run the method on their own panoramas and immediately inspect depth, normals, and the reconstructed 3D point cloud, and
โข gain intuition for how single-image geometry estimation transfers from perspective to the full 360ยฐ setting.
